Rotator Cuff Tear Us. The rotator cuff is a group of muscles that attach via tendons to the head of the upper arm bone (the humerus). The rotator cuff tendons cover the head of the humerus (upper arm bone), helping you to raise and rotate your arm. Rotator cuff injuries are most often caused by progressive wear and tear of the tendon tissue over time. A partial or complete rotator cuff tear makes it difficult to raise and move your arm.
